The move towards personalized medicine derived from individually focused clinical chemistry measurements has been translated by the human anti‐doping movement over the past decade into developing the athlete biological passport. There is considerable potential for animal sports to adapt this model to facilitate an intelligence‐based anti‐doping system. Copyright © 2017 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.
